2-Chlorotrityl chloride is widely utilized in research focused on:
Solid-Phase Synthesis: This compound serves as a key reagent in solid-phase peptide synthesis, allowing researchers to create complex peptides efficiently. Its ability to form stable linkages makes it ideal for generating diverse peptide libraries.
Drug Development: In medicinal chemistry, it is used for the synthesis of various pharmaceutical compounds. Its reactivity enables the introduction of functional groups that can enhance the biological activity of drug candidates.
